Utils: Merge BaseValidatingLineEdit into FancyLineEdit

Change-Id: Idb7a6f28ac41bacbfd2603feb8b786c31d3769e3
Reviewed-by: Eike Ziller <eike.ziller@digia.com>
Reviewed-by: Christian Stenger <christian.stenger@digia.com>
This commit is contained in:
hjk
2014-02-13 16:13:54 +01:00
parent a74de6af81
commit 680209aef5
18 changed files with 226 additions and 345 deletions

View File

@@ -65,7 +65,7 @@ ClassNameValidatingLineEditPrivate:: ClassNameValidatingLineEditPrivate() :
// --------------------- ClassNameValidatingLineEdit
ClassNameValidatingLineEdit::ClassNameValidatingLineEdit(QWidget *parent) :
Utils::BaseValidatingLineEdit(parent),
Utils::FancyLineEdit(parent),
d(new ClassNameValidatingLineEditPrivate)
{
updateRegExp();
@@ -123,9 +123,8 @@ bool ClassNameValidatingLineEdit::validate(const QString &value, QString *errorM
return true;
}
void ClassNameValidatingLineEdit::slotChanged(const QString &t)
void ClassNameValidatingLineEdit::handleChanged(const QString &t)
{
Utils::BaseValidatingLineEdit::slotChanged(t);
if (isValid()) {
// Suggest file names, strip namespaces
QString fileName = d->m_lowerCaseFileName ? t.toLower() : t;